Risk Factors
• History of thromboembolism / Inherited thrombophilia • e.g. prolonged bedridden in hospital, traction for lower limb fracture especially pelvic, lower limb surgery
•
Immobility
• Therefore, if suspect PE, also ask about any recent Hx of hospitalization
•
Surgery (Post-operation)
• Malignancy
• Active inflammation
• Pregnancy / COCP / HRT

: Cardiac USG for massive acute pulmonary embolism
e.g. in ED setting
Signs
May not be detected in small PE load which does not produce significant right heart strain approaching / exceeding size of left ventricle Normally right ventricular apex is sharp • less than 5 mm; measured in subcostal 4-chamber view • Paradoxical bowing of septum into left ventricle hypomotility of RV free wall with relative apical sparing Pulmonary embolism
–
Large
–
Thin
• Normal RV thickness but enlarged RV suggest acute RV pressure overload
–
D-shaped left ventricle
• Normally interventricular septum is round during systole & diastole as LV pressure is always higher than RV pressure
